Title :
Calculation of experimental apparatus for biological object irradiation by impulse electromagnetic field

Abstract :
The problem of homogeneous irradiation of biological solutions by impulse electromagnetic field is investigated. The optimization of construction and sizes of the apparatus for the irradiation is carried out by direct numerical calculation in time domain. Uniformity of heat distribution is studied.
